1 Calculus Section 2.4 The Chain Rule

2 Used for finding the derivative of composite functions Think dimensional analysis Ex. Change 17hours to seconds

3 The derivative of y with respect to x With Respect to… The derivative of y with respect to u The derivative of u with respect to x

4 The Chain Rule

5 The derivative of the outside function times the derivative of the inside function.

6 The Process

7 The General Power Rule A special case of The Chain Rule for finding the derivative of a composite function where the inside function is raised to a power.

8 The General Power Rule Power out in front. Keep what’s inside to one less power. Multiply by the derivative of what’s inside.
